How are decentralized applications (dApps) benefiting from the rise of Layer 2 solutions?
The Evolution of Decentralized Applications (dApps) with Layer 2 Solutions
Introduction
Decentralized applications (dApps) have revolutionized the way users interact with digital services by offering transparency and decentralization. However, as these platforms gained popularity, scalability issues became apparent. This led to the emergence of Layer 2 solutions, which aim to enhance dApp performance by offloading computational tasks from the main blockchain.
Understanding Layer 2 Solutions
Layer 2 solutions are a set of technologies designed to improve blockchain network scalability and usability. These solutions operate on top of the main blockchain (Layer 1) and include off-chain transactions, state channels, sidechains, and rollups.
Enhancing dApps Through Layer 2 Solutions
Scalability Benefits:
- Increased Capacity: By reducing the load on the main blockchain, Layer 2 solutions can handle higher transaction volumes.
- Faster Transaction Times: Reduced congestion leads to quicker transaction processing times for improved user experience.
Cost Efficiency:
- Lower Fees: With fewer transactions on the main blockchain, gas fees decrease.
- Improved User Experience: Lower fees encourage more frequent use of dApps.
Security Measures:
- Enhanced Security Protocols: Advanced security measures ensure secure off-chain transactions.
- Reduced Risk of Attacks: Decreased number of transactions lowers vulnerability to attacks like a 51% attack.
Interoperability Advantages:
- Cross-Chain Transactions: Enable seamless interaction between different blockchains.
- Ecosystem Development: Facilitates building complex and integrated applications within a cohesive ecosystem.
Recent Developments in Layer 2 Integration
Ethereum's Transition to Ethereum 2.0:
- Implementation of Optimism, Polygon (formerly Matic), and Arbitrum for enhanced scalability.
Polkadot and Cosmos Integration:
- Leveraging various Layer 2 solutions for improved scalability and usability.
Industry Adoption:
- Prominent dApps like Uniswap and SushiSwap witness significant improvements in speed and cost efficiency post integration with Layer 2 solutions.
Potential Challenges Ahead
Complexity in Implementation
- Requires advanced understanding from developers and users alike.
Regulatory Uncertainty
- Regulatory frameworks may need adjustments to accommodate unique aspects of Layer 2 transactions.
Security Risks
- Despite robust security protocols, vulnerabilities could compromise transaction security.
Interoperability Standards
- Lack of standardized protocols may hinder widespread adoption due to ecosystem fragmentation.
Looking Towards a Bright Future for dApps
The integration of Layer 2 solutions marks a significant advancement for decentralized applications by addressing scalability challenges effectively while enhancing user experience across various platforms like Ethereum, Polkadot, Cosmos among others.
This article provides an insightful overview into how decentralized applications are leveraging the benefits offered by rising layer two solutions while also highlighting potential challenges that need addressing moving forward within this dynamic landscape in blockchain technology evolution.

Hot Topics


